Hello friends, I\'m K.Gopi Krishna from 2011 batch (Ms VLSI & Embedded systems). And here\'s my personal experience at INFOTECH On Campus drive in JNTUH.
The selection process was.
1. Online Test (Aptitude and Technical).
2. Technical HR.
3. HR.
Online test is for 60 minutes consists 60 questions. Out of which 30 technical 10 Verbal ability and 20 Aptitude. And we have sectional cut off. Technical was a bit easy If you are good at B-Tech basics then it\'s a cake walk.
Aptitude was a bit time consuming better solve technical first save some time for aptitude. The questions were tricky yet easy. I suggest R.S agarwal Verbal and APTITUDE. Try solving all the variety of problems.
Topics covered:
ALLEGATION AND MIXTURES,
PARTNERSHIPS,
PROFIT AND LOSS,
AVERAGES,
PERCENTAGE,
PERMUTATIONS AND COMBINATIONS,
COMPOUND INTEREST,
BOATS STREAMS,
TIME AND WORK.
The questions are from the above mentioned topics next section was data interpretation Data Interpretation (10 ques).
Coming to Verbal ability this is also not very difficult. For those who prepared for GRE, that might come handy. The questions asked were Analogy, Fill in the blanks.
First 5 questions are based on Reading Comprehension. Next 3 questions finding the synonym (moderate level) And 3 questions based on analogies, 2 questions fill the blanks with appropriate word(Intermediate level). Next 30 questions were Technical which was easy as I mentioned earlier.
Technical HR:
Confidence and cool headed attitude will make a huge difference .They asked questions dependent on the info given on my resume/CV so be confident on what you put on the resume. They were trying to confuse repeatedly asking "Are you sure- Are you sure". Don\'t fumble justify your answer whether right or wrong. They asked me questions from DFT, Digital design, and also from C (regarding storage and length).
HR:
This is the thing nothing to worry. They asked to tell about myself followed by questions like where would you prefer to work, career goals, where do you expect yourself after 5 years.
